LINCOLN PREMIUM POULTRY
JOB DESCRIPTION
JOB TITLE: Pre-Op Technician
DATE: 8/2026
REPORTS TO: Sanitation Manager
STATUS: Non-Exempt
CORE VALUE COMMITMENT:
All employees will demonstrate our culture of commitment to quality, respect for fellow employees and business partners, and responsibility to the environment and our community.
JOB SUMMARY:
Responsible for helping to ensure product quality and safety of products produced. Communicate non-compliance issues to production manager or supervisor. Verify and document regulatory programs (HACCP, SSOP, GMP and product labeling). Follow and comply with company procedures and policies set by management team and customer specifications.
DAILY D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Creates and ensures compliance to all regulatory standards as well as provides documentation for HACCP, USDA, SSOP’s, and GMP’s.
- Record temperature and key information on data logs.
- Read and follow company policies and procedures, as well as plant product specifications.
- Work collectively with USDA and provide vital communication on product statuses to department managers and supervisors.
- Assist in providing backup and training to new employees.
- Calculate product compliance percentages and complete data entry of product evaluations.
- Gather products for micro testing and verify code dates, ingredients, and labels.
- Document product information and develop preventative action to combat product defects.
- Ability to work in a team environment.
- Skill in being a self-starter.
- Ability to communicate in a courteous and professional manner.
REQUIREMENTS OF THE POSITION:
- MUST possess a minimum of 1 year experience in a QA/QC or sanitation environment, preferably in a food manufacturing setting.
- MUST be familiar with food safety standards as well as federal, state, and USDA guidelines.
- Ability to comprehend and follow instructions.
- Skill in using a personal computer and various software applications, including Microsoft Excel, Word and Outlook.
- MUST be a team player.
- MUST have knowledge of basic math, including addition, subtraction, division, multiplication and calculating percentages.
- MUST be able to communicate effectively in English, both verbally and in writing.
- Ability to work in a refrigerated environment ranging from 45-50 degrees Fahrenheit.
- MUST be able to work in a fast-paced environment and adapt to frequent changes to the needs of production.
- MUST be able to pass required physical including demonstrating your ability to lift the required weight for each position.
- MUST be able to stand and/or walk for entire 8-hour shift.
- MUST wear correct job specific PPE as designated by company policy.
PREFERRED EXPERIENCE:
- Experience working in a manufacturing, production, or warehouse environment preferred.
- Associate degree in Food Sciences, Biology, Chemistry, or a related field preferred.

How do I time my application to Lincoln Premium Poultry around the H-1B cap season?
The H-1B cap registration window opens in March each year, with petitions filed in April for an October 1 start date. To give Lincoln Premium Poultry enough time to prepare your petition, aim to secure an offer by January or February at the latest. Starting your job search in Q3 or Q4 of the prior year gives you the best chance of being ready when registration opens.
